Desription of Work This non-personal services contract requires the contractor to provide all necessary personnel, equipment, materials, and labor to remove and replace 16 nonfunctional ductless heat pump A/C systems with new, cooling-only split A/C systems. The work will take place across multiple First Special Forces Group (Airborne) headquarters and augmentation facilities (Buildings 9160/9162, 9190, 9934, and 9983) to establish optimal operational temperatures for critical computer and communication systems. The contractor operates independently under its own supervision, remaining fully accountable to the Government for meeting all performance standards. The scope of work includes disconnecting and reconnecting power and refrigerant lines, removing and disposing of the nonworking units, and installing and testing the new cooling-only units.
